Sipadan

Malaysia · Sabah, Borneo
Profundidad: 5–40 mNivel: Advanced Open WaterApril-December

Malaysia's only oceanic island: an extinct volcanic pinnacle coated in living coral that rises some 600 m from the seabed, so that the wall drops sheer a few metres from the shore. Barracuda Point is the iconic site; Turtle Cavern opens in the wall at around 18-20 m and calls for specific training.

Protection status

Área protegida gestionada por Sabah Parks; permiso diario con cupo limitado, certificación mínima Advanced Open Water y un máximo de dos inmersiones por permiso desde septiembre de 2022

Did you know

El sistema interior (Turtle Tomb) contiene esqueletos de tortugas que entraron y no encontraron la salida, además de restos de un delfín.
